If you’re already using Jabra Evolve2 30 headsets, these ear cushions are a sensible, low-effort way to get your audio comfort back without replacing the whole headset. £51.10 ex-VAT for 10 pairs is decent value for a small team, a helpdesk that issues headsets, or any office with shared devices—especially because worn pads can make even “fine” audio feel uncomfortable and sweaty, and comfort issues usually show up faster than hardware failures.
That said, I wouldn’t buy this just to “stock up” unless you know your Evolve2 30s are going to be in active rotation. Cushion longevity varies a lot with usage habits (heat, headset type, how often staff wear them, cleaning routines), and you don’t get to use them until the originals start feeling rough. Also, if you’re trying to fix microphone or sound quality problems, these pads won’t help much—those are often down to fit, firmware, or damage elsewhere. Bottom line: buy if you’re maintaining existing Evolve2 30 setups for comfort and hygiene; skip it if you’re chasing performance issues or don’t have the headset model already.
